Leleti Khumalo is a South African actress best known for her roles in the films Sarafina! and Yesterday; and as Busi in the SABC1 soapie Generations.
Mpumelelo Bhulose is a South African actor best known for his starring role as Muzi Xulu, a gangster and self made man, on the SABC1 telenovela Uzalo.
Tony Kgoroge is a South African actor best known to television audiences for his leading roles in the series Gaz'lam (2002-2003) and Zero Tolerance (2004), both of which he left after one season
Thembi Mtshali-Jones is a South African singer, actress and playwright best known for her starring role as aspiring actress Thoko on the CCV sitcom 'Sgudi 'Snaysi, from 1986-1992
Sandile Dlamini is a South African musician and actor best known for his starring role as Phakade in the e.tv soapie Imbewu: The Seed.
Jailoshini Naidoo is a South African presenter and actress best known for hosting the SABC2 lifestyle and entertainment show Eastern Mosaic.
Koobeshen Naidoo is a South African actor best known for his starring role as Pranav Rampersad in the e.tv soapie Imbewu: The Seed.
Fundi Zwane is a South African actress and businesswoman best known for her recurring role as Rethabile in the SABC1 soapie Generations.
Kajal Maharaj is a South African television presenter, actress, dancer and model best known as the presenter of Dharma Moments.
Nqobile Ndlovu is a South African actress best known for her starring role as Nobuhle Zungu in the SABC1 drama series Ingozi.
Jack Devnarain is a South African actor best known for his long-running, starring role as Rajesh Kumar in the SABC3 soap opera Isidingo
Nkanyiso Mchunu is a South African actor best known for his recurring role as Justice in the SABC1 drama series Ingozi.
Raphael Griffiths is a South African actor, musician and presenter best known for his role as Vusi Mukwevho on the SABC2 soapie Muvhango.
Nokubonga Khuzwayo is a South African actress, singer and dancer best known for her role as Zakithi in the e.tv soapie Imbewu: The Seed.
Brenda Mhlongo is a South African actress best known for her role as Nandi on the SABC1 soapie Generations: The Legacy.
Muzi Mthabela is a South African actor, editor and former model best known for his recurring role as Duma on the Mzansi Magic soapie Isibaya.
Lusanda Mbane is a South African entrepreneur and actress best known for her role as Boniswa Langa on the e.tv soapie Scandal!.
Kay Sibiya is a South African actor and television presenter best known for his starring role as Ayanda Mdletshe in the SABC1 telenovela Uzalo.
